Is Normative suitable for UK companies under SECR and UK SRS requirements?
Yes, Normative provides strong UK compliance capabilities though it's not UK-native like Climatise. The platform supports SECR reporting formats and integrates 1 UK Government DESNZ conversion factors. However, UK-specific formatting and regulatory nuances require some manual configuration.
For UK SRS S2 climate reporting, Normative's enterprise features shine with comprehensive Scope 3 capabilities and robust assurance documentation. The platform works well for large UK companies with complex corporate structures requiring sophisticated carbon accounting beyond basic SECR compliance.
What makes Normative's calculation engine different from other platforms?
Normative employs a third-party validated calculation engine that has undergone independent verification by external auditing firms. This validation covers methodology accuracy, 2 GHG Protocol compliance, and calculation reliability across all emission scopes and categories.
The validated engine provides additional confidence for companies preparing for third-party assurance requirements under UK SRS implementation. Independent validation can reduce assurance scope and costs by providing pre-verified calculation foundations that assurance providers can rely on.
How does Normative handle complex corporate structures for carbon consolidation?
Normative excels at multi-entity carbon consolidation for complex corporate structures common among UK listed companies. The platform supports equity share, financial control, and operational control consolidation approaches aligned with 3 GHG Protocol Corporate Standard requirements.
Advanced features include subsidiary-level reporting, joint venture handling, and acquisition/divestiture modeling. This capability is particularly valuable for large UK companies with international operations preparing for enhanced UK SRS compliance requirements that demand consolidated group-level reporting.
What is Normative pricing and implementation timeline?
Normative operates on enterprise pricing typically ranging from £50,000-£150,000 annually for large UK companies, depending on scope and complexity. Implementation timelines average 12-16 weeks due to comprehensive setup required for enterprise-grade features and integrations.
While more expensive than mid-market alternatives, the investment is justified for companies needing sophisticated carbon accounting, complex consolidation, and enterprise-grade data governance. The platform provides dedicated customer success management and ongoing methodology support included in enterprise packages.
Can Normative integrate with existing enterprise systems?
Yes, Normative provides extensive API integration capabilities with major ERP systems (SAP, Oracle), data warehouses, and financial reporting platforms commonly used by UK enterprises. The platform supports automated data ingestion reducing manual data collection overhead.
Integration capabilities include real-time data synchronization, automated calculation updates, and seamless export to corporate reporting systems. This enterprise integration approach aligns well with UK SRS implementation timelines, where ongoing automated reporting becomes the norm rather than an annual exercise — particularly if the FCA's CP26/5 proposals are confirmed for 1 January 2027.
